NEWS IN ADVERTISEMENTS
Good entries of all live stock will be offered by T. Cunningham and Co. at their market salg Jo-morrow, including several veiy choice lots. On the front page of this issue A. Simmonds and Co., Ltd., have a change advt. mentioning to farmers and orchardists that the wonderful Blue Lupin for green manure supplies will again be short this season; also their new bulbs and seeds have arrived. Messrs Gill Bros, remind the public of their weekly market sale at 10.30 to-morrow. Fruit and produce, of which there is a big variety, will be sold, some really well-bred pullets, also ducks and table birds being listed. Pigs are exceptionally good. A special line of 50 slips and weaners is coming to hand. The cattle include a Jersey-cross cow title to third calf this month and is guaranteed to come in sound. Sundries are numerous and useful.
